DIGEST AND PURPOSE 

Current law allows doctors of podiatry or dentistry to create jointly
owned, managed, or operated health care facilities in the form of
professional associations.  H.B. 3153 authorizes one or more persons duly
licensed to practice chiropractic to form certain professional
associations.

SECTION BY SECTION ANALYSIS

SECTION 1.  Amends Section 2(A), Texas Professional Association Act
(Article 1528f, V.T.C.S.), to read as follows: 

(A)  Formation.  Authorizes any one or more persons duly licensed to
practice a profession, including podiatry, dentistry, or chiropractic,
under the laws of this state to, by complying with this Act, form a
professional association, as distinguished from either a partnership or a
corporation, by associating themselves for the purpose of performing
professional services and dividing the gains therefrom as stated in
articles of association or bylaws. 

SECTION 2.  Effective date: upon passage or September 1, 2001.
